Musical reading in Perg: Richard Schneebauer takes a stand against violence
A special event will take place in Perg, organized as part of the “16 Days Against Violence” campaign. The Perg women's advice center invites anyone interested to a musical reading with the well-known artist Richard Schneebauer. This initiative aims to draw attention to the issues of violence and discrimination and to provide a platform for discussion and reflection.
Richard Schneebauer will touch his audience with his artistic performance. He combines music with storytelling to draw attention to the pressing social issues addressed in the campaign. This reading represents not only entertainment, but also an important message: violence in all its forms must end. Using art as a tool to address such serious issues is significant and shows how culture can contribute to change.
